Position Overview:
The Supply Chain Manager will be responsible for managing suppliers, lead times, and inventory levels to ensure a steady flow of parts, components and materials for production.
This role will analyze sales forecasts, coordinate with suppliers to confirm delivery schedules, negotiate pricing, and manage backup suppliers as needed.
The Supply Chain Manager will work within Infor ERP to track inventory, set reorder points, and optimize stock levels. Additionally, they will oversee a Purchasing & Inventory Planning Specialist and ensure timely procurement and supplier compliance manufacturing operations.
Key Responsibilities:
- Manage supplier relationships to ensure quality, lead times, and cost targets are met.
- Analyze sales forecasts to anticipate material needs and adjust orders and timing of orders accordingly.
- Negotiate pricing and terms with suppliers to drive cost savings.
- Identify and establish backup suppliers to mitigate supply risks.
- Monitor supplier performance and ensure on-time deliveries.
- Work within Infor ERP to track inventory, manage reorder points, and optimize stock levels.
- Determine inventory strategies, deciding which parts to keep in stock and at what levels.
- Oversee purchase orders (POs) and ensure timely supplier confirmations.
- Track and manage critical components such as automation parts, motors, compressors, pressure vessels, and heat exchangers.
- Ensure materials are available for assembly in line with production schedules.
- Communicate with suppliers to confirm delivery dates and resolve delays.
- Address supply chain disruptions quickly to prevent production slowdowns.
- Work cross-functionally with engineering, production, and sales teams to align supply chain operations with business goals.
- Supervise the Purchasing & Inventory Planning Specialist to ensure purchasing and inventory tasks are completed accurately.
- Provide guidance and support to improve supply chain processes.
- Implement best practices to enhance efficiency and cost control.
